Tokyo Racecourse

東京競馬場

Tokyo Racecourse is one of Japan's premier horse racing venues and serves as a primary setting for many races depicted in Umamusume. The iconic grandstand and track layout are faithfully recreated in the anime, making it the most significant pilgrimage site for fans.

Scene from the Anime

Featured prominently in multiple episodes showing various races including the Japan Derby and other major competitions, with detailed shots of the paddock, grandstand, and winner's circle

Access

Nearest Station: Fuchu-Keiba-Seimon-mae Station

Direct access from Fuchu-Keiba-Seimon-mae Station on the Keio Line, 1-minute walk to the main entrance

東京都府中市日吉町1番1号

Recommended visit: 120 min

Visitor Tips

Race days for authentic atmosphere, weekdays for quieter visits

Very crowded on race days, moderate on non-race days

Photography allowed in public areas, restrictions in certain zones

Spring and autumn offer the most comfortable weather for visits
